Surrey v Cambridge University
University Match 1902
VenueKennington Oval, Kennington on 19th, 20th, 21st June 1902 (3-day match)
Balls per over6
TossCambridge University won the toss and decided to bat
ResultCambridge University won by 44 runs
UmpiresVA Titchmarsh, W Wright
Close of play day 1Surrey (1) 98/7 (Jephson 27*, Nice 1*)
Close of play day 2Cambridge University (2) 90/3 (Dowson 43*, ER Wilson 3*)

Notes
--> DLA Jephson (1) passed 7500 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 39
--> EM Dowson reached 50 wickets in First-Class matches for the season when taking his 8th wicket in the Surrey second innings

Play did not start until 3.30 pm on the 2nd day due to rain. 'Surrey have in Strudwick a wicketkeeper who is likely to make a great reputation' - The Sportsman
